Uses another move chosen according to the terrain. Terrain | Selected move ------------------------- | ------------------ Building | Tri Attack Cave | Rock Slide Deep water | Hydro Pump Desert | Earthquake Grass | Seed Bomb Mountain | Rock Slide Road | Earthquake Shallow water | Hydro Pump Snow | Blizzard Tall grass | Seed Bomb Electric Terrain | Thunderbolt Grassy Terrain | Energy Ball Misty Terrain | Moonblast In Pokémon Battle Revolution: Terrain | Selected move -------------- | ------------------ Courtyard | Tri Attack Crystal | Rock Slide Gateway | Hydro Pump Magma | Rock Slide Main Street | Tri Attack Neon | Tri Attack Stargazer | Rock Slide Sunny Park | Seed Bomb Sunset | Earthquake Waterfall | Seed Bomb This move cannot be copied by Mirror Move.
